Bookkeeping in Riyadh: what to know
Running a business in Riyadh means bookkeeping is not just good financial practice — it is a compliance foundation. Every transaction needs to be recorded in a way that feeds correctly into your ZATCA e-invoicing system, supports your quarterly VAT return at 15%, and satisfies Zakat obligations for Saudi-owned entities. One misclassified expense category can cascade into a VAT discrepancy and a ZATCA audit.
Frequently asked questions
Why do I need a dedicated bookkeeper in Riyadh rather than doing it myself?
ZATCA e-invoicing compliance requires your books to be structured to produce technically valid invoices in real time. Errors in bookkeeping — wrong VAT categories, missing cost centres, unreconciled bank entries — create problems at the VAT return stage that are difficult to fix retroactively. A professional bookkeeper prevents these issues upstream.
How much does bookkeeping cost per month in Riyadh?
For small businesses with under 100 monthly transactions, bookkeeping in Riyadh typically ranges from SAR 500 to SAR 1,200 per month. Mid-sized businesses with 100–500 transactions and payroll management typically pay SAR 1,500–2,500. VAT return filing is often an additional SAR 300–600 per quarter.
Do bookkeeping firms in Riyadh handle ZATCA e-invoicing?
Yes. All KSA-based partners in this directory are experienced with ZATCA Phase 2 e-invoicing, including Fatoora platform connectivity, UUID and QR code generation, and XML invoice compliance. Bookkeepers familiar with Wafeq handle this natively through the platform.
What is SOCPA and why does it matter when choosing a bookkeeper?
SOCPA is the Saudi Organization for Certified Public Accountants. Certification is required for statutory audit and is a mark of professional accountability. While not mandatory for bookkeeping engagements, a SOCPA-certified firm provides an additional layer of professional credibility and accountability.
